Experiencing an injury can be overwhelming, bringing about stress and confusion. It's crucial to remain calm and take the right steps early on, even though no one expects to get hurt. Here's a guide to help protect your health and legal rights in Syracuse, NY.
Gather All Relevant Information
Start by collecting important evidence. This includes medical records, police reports, photographs of injuries or the accident scene, and contact information of witnesses. Writing a detailed account of the event helps solidify your memory, which can be critical later in the legal process.
Seek Immediate Medical Attention
Prioritize your health by seeking immediate medical care, even if the injury seems minor. Delays may worsen your condition and impact any potential legal case. When speaking with your doctor, avoid exaggeration but make sure to mention all pain points.
Stay Silent About Your Case
Limit discussions about your case to your doctor and attorney. It's crucial to protect your legal rights by staying 'mum' about your case, especially with insurance agents or opposing legal counsel, and always in the presence of your lawyer.
Find a Trusted Attorney
Once immediate health concerns are addressed, consider hiring an experienced personal injury attorney in Syracuse. Seek recommendations from trusted sources—family, friends, or colleagues. An attorney with a successful history in personal injury cases can significantly influence your recovery and legal outcome.
